Environment Canada has issued heat warnings for the Ottawa area as temperatures are expected to be as high as 35 C in the coming days.
The heat wave is expected to last from Sunday until Tuesday, Environment Canada said in an alert issued Saturday afternoon.
In Ottawa, the daytime highs are expected to range from 31 to 35 C. Temperatures will drop to 20 to 22 C overnight, the weather agency said.
